Transaction 663892e3a365362cd97614dd4023fb33cb39ff40173ca45130b752a14c1a3ca6
1 Input
1 Output
-
663892e3a365362cd97614dd4023fb33cb39ff40173ca45130b752a14c1a3ca6:0
- value
- 651613
- script pubkey
- OP_0 OP_PUSHBYTES_20 e9b21d4541e9b4b6efb2a53e57bee450a1d75915
- address
- bc1qaxep632pax6tdmaj55l900hy2zsawkg4wr0ncm